The fastest-shrinking municipalities in canton Jura

National ranking

Grandfontaine is shrinking fastest in canton Jura: its population fell -4.2 % in 2025. Next come Les Enfers (-4 %) and Ederswiler (-3.5 %). The basis is the year’s population change. Source: FSO (BEVNAT).

How we measure this

BFS

Change in the permanent resident population during calendar year 2025, in percent of the population on 1 January, from the FSO statistics on natural population movement (BEVNAT) and migration. This ranking shows the same measure from the other end: the steepest declines first. A negative value means shrinkage.

Why do some municipalities shrink?
The year’s population change comes from births, deaths and in/out-migration (FSO BEVNAT). When deaths and departures outweigh births and arrivals, the population falls. The percentage makes small and large municipalities comparable.
